Is 116 082 510 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 116 082 510 is about 10 774.159.

Thus, the square root of 116 082 510 is not an integer, and therefore 116 082 510 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 116 082 510?

The square of a number (here 116 082 510) is the result of the product of this number (116 082 510) by itself (i.e., 116 082 510 × 116 082 510); the square of 116 082 510 is sometimes called "raising 116 082 510 to the power 2", or "116 082 510 squared".

The square of 116 082 510 is 13 475 149 127 900 100 because 116 082 510 × 116 082 510 = 116 082 5102 = 13 475 149 127 900 100.

As a consequence, 116 082 510 is the square root of 13 475 149 127 900 100.
